N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Weegschaal 15 sits in the leafy Hulzebraak area of Schijndel. With 196 m² of living space on a 452 m² plot, it offers plenty of room for a family. The home was built in 1999 and has an A energy label, so it's efficient to run. At €850,000, the asking price is 21% above the neighbourhood average of €704,778, which puts it on the high side compared to other detached houses in Meierijstad.
Hulzebraak is a residential area with a mix of families and older residents. Most homes are owner-occupied (69%) and built between 1990 and 2010. The neighbourhood has a moderate urban feel, with around 1,040 addresses per km². There are no resident reviews available for this area, so the impression comes from the data: a quiet, well-established community with a high proportion of families. The neighbourhood Hulzebraak is known for its green spaces and low crime rate (34 incidents total).
For your morning bread, Jumbo is just around the corner, and Albert Heijn is a ten-minute walk away. There are several primary schools nearby: Basisschool De Regenboog is a couple of streets away, and Openbare Basisschool de Kring is a ten-minute walk. A park or public garden is just around the corner, perfect for an evening stroll. The municipality Meierijstad offers a good range of amenities, with a restaurant 0.9 km away and a library 1.9 km.

The asking price is 21% above the average asking price in Hulzebraak (€704,778), so it is on the high side. However, this home is larger than average (196 m² vs 177 m²) and has an A energy label, which may justify the premium. The neighbourhood has a mix of price ranges, from €470,000 to €1,080,000.
Hulzebraak is a family-friendly area with many households with children (375 out of 775). The average household size is 2.5 people. There are several primary schools within walking distance, and the area has a low crime rate. Most homes are owner-occupied and built after 1990, giving a modern feel.
The home has an A energy label, which is very efficient. In the neighbourhood, 66.7% of homes have label A, so this is in line with the local standard. You can expect low energy costs compared to older homes.
The nearest train station is 11.3 km away, so the area is car-dependent.
